PHILADELPHIA (WPVI) -- A legendary Philadelphia spoken-word artist and hip-hop poet has passed away.

Lamar Manson, better known by his stage name Black Ice, died on Wednesday surrounded by loved ones.

He is widely recognized as the first poet signed to Def Jam Records and as a star of the Def Poetry Jam TV and Broadway shows.

Manson was a Tony-, Peabody-, and Emmy Award-winning artist.

He was 54 years old.
